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ly the 33433 ZIP Code Apartments

How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ly 33433 Apartment?

The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in 33433 is $1,827.

What is the largest Pet Friendly 33433 Apartment for rent?

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in 33433 is a 1,600 square feet unit starting from $1,600 at Chestnut Mansion LLC.

What is the average size for 33433 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in 33433 is currently at 599 sq ft.
